Output afe8712af40b768db8b924cc94de6cde8bdf43fc940178c12b19890e80742c97:0

value
2310722910
script pubkey
OP_HASH160 OP_PUSHBYTES_20 79e5f5095a7d5ee80a5c2801c9a646ae66bdddc1 OP_EQUAL
address
3CoZATczEtphRZ6aJRHgXeSVLCku973b4P
transaction
afe8712af40b768db8b924cc94de6cde8bdf43fc940178c12b19890e80742c97
confirmations
400488
spent
true